>>9649431
This is honestly the only real answer if you want to know classical conservatism and the traditionalist variety of it.

Russell Kirk compiled some books with essays from conservative thinkers from Burke to the 20th century, in addition to writing his own essays.

"A Conservative Mind" is what he's known for, and it traces the Anglo-American brand of conservatism from Burke onward.

I own pic related which features some of the thinkers from A Conservative Mind, it's worth reading if you want to get to know the foundations of conservative thought.
